Abstract

A connector for establishing electrical connections with a PCB comprises first and second sets of contact pads arranged in first and second rows on a same surface of the PCB. The connector includes a first set of elongated contacts, a second set of elongated contacts, and a contact block. The first set of contacts have contact surfaces that form a first row of contact surfaces configured to make and break electrical connectivity with the first set of contact pads of the PCB. The second set of contacts have contact surfaces that form a second row of contact surfaces configured to make and break electrical connectivity with the second set of contact pads of the PCB. The contact block supports the first and second sets of contacts and causes the contact surfaces to wipe against the first and second sets of contact pads when making and breaking electrical connectivity therewith.

Description

technical field [0001] This application generally relates to electrical connectors and related methods. Background technique [0002] Electrical connectors have been developed for a variety of applications. For example, conventional test equipment utilizes electrical connectors and arrays of test probes to connect circuit board electronics and electronic devices under test. Such test equipment has been used to test electronic devices from various industries such as computing, automotive and telecommunications. While such test equipment is generally effective and has been used in these industries for many years, the density of electrical connectors utilized by such test equipment is limited. Therefore, in some cases it cannot be used to test devices with a larger number of contact pads or with some types of arrays of contact pads.
